From ad62e5533be104fb34c1e4faf09239cf4efafbcb Mon Sep 17 00:00:00 2001 From: Don Gagne Date: Thu, 9 Mar 2023 09:19:44 -0800 Subject: [PATCH] FactMetaData: Fix default for decimal places (#10589) When metadata was loaded from JSON and decimal places weren't specified it was set to 0 when it should have been set to kUknownDecimalPlaces (which will in turn default to 3). --------- Co-authored-by: Don Gagne --- src/FactSystem/FactMetaData.cc |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/FactSystem/FactMetaData.cc b/src/FactSystem/FactMetaData.cc index 6abd31c..e8d8dfa 100644 --- a/src/FactSystem/FactMetaData.cc +++ b/src/FactSystem/FactMetaData.cc @@ -1337,7 +1337,7 @@ FactMetaData* FactMetaData::createFromJsonObject(const QJsonObject& json, QMapsetDecimalPlaces(json[_decimalPlacesJsonKey].toInt(0)); + metaData->setDecimalPlaces(json[_decimalPlacesJsonKey].toInt(kUnknownDecimalPlaces)); metaData->setShortDescription(json[_shortDescriptionJsonKey].toString()); metaData->setLongDescription(json[_longDescriptionJsonKey].toString());